Payment and Withdrawal Rules
The cashier accepts cards, e-wallets, crypto and bank transfers. Deposits must come from an account in your own name – no third-party payments. Withdrawals have hard limits, and the casino enforces them strictly:
- Maximum £2,000 per day, £10,000 per week, £40,000 per month
- Only one withdrawal request can be active at a time
- Requests are usually processed within 36 hours, but security checks can take up to 30 days
- Each deposit must be wagered three times before withdrawal – that’s the threefold turnover rule, separate from bonus wagering
You’ll also need to complete email and phone verification, and have your ID and address proof ready before you ask for a payout. Skipping that step means delays.
